## Idempotency Keys for Payment Retries (Lumopay)

Every retry of a charge request must reuse the original idempotency key; generating a new key on retry can produce duplicate charges. Keys are scoped per merchant and expire after 48 hours. Reviewers should verify keys are derived server-side, never from client input. The full key-generation specification and threat model are maintained on the internal page.

dashboard of kaguf-tawip = https://vault.merlaqsys.test/issue

Handover note for the incoming contractor on Brightkettle firmware:

The update channel for Brightkettle devices is split into `stable`, `canary`, and `bench`. Never promote a build straight to stable — it must bake in canary for 72 hours, and Orla signs off on the rollout gate. Rollbacks are manual and require the device cohort ID from the fleet dashboard. The full promotion checklist, signing steps, and cohort map are kept on the internal page here.

dashboard of yahaf-kajep = https://jira.zemvarsys.internal/display/projects/browse/browse/a08b

**FAQ: How do I run the Tallowbridge inventory reconciliation job locally?**

Reviewers often need to replay the nightly reconciliation to verify diff logic before approving changes. The job compares warehouse counts against the Ledgermist snapshot and emits a discrepancy report; please check that your change doesn't alter tolerance thresholds without a ticket. Local replays require the sealed test fixture bundle, which decrypts only on approved machines. To open the fixture bundle, supply the recovery passphrase shown directly below.

strongbox words: sorir-belvan-rusix-ulays-ralmir-praix-eliir-tamax-praael-druael-julir-tamius-jorir

# Billing worker — blue-green deploy config.
# Notes for the weekly eng sync: Ledgerline's billing worker now runs
# two colored stacks; traffic shifts when health checks pass on the
# idle color. Each color reads this shared env file, so changes here
# affect both stacks on next rollout. Cutover is handled by the deploy
# script; do not flip colors manually. The stacks authenticate to the
# payment gateway using the credential on the following line:

sealed setting: ARCHIVE_KEY3=8d0